Keeping your water softener in tip-top shape is crucial for delivering you soft, clean water. Here are some basic maintenance tips to maintain your system functions smoothly and improves its lifespan.

  • Periodically inspect your softener for any leaks.
  • Drain the brine tank as needed to remove salt buildup.
  • Measure your water hardness levels regularly to fine-tune the softener's settings.
  • Change the resin beads periodically.

Following these simple maintenance tips can help to keeping your water softener running effectively. Remember to always refer to the manufacturer's instructions for specific maintenance advice.

Boost the Life of Your Water Softener System with Regular Care

Regular maintenance plays a crucial role in extending the lifespan of your water softener system. By incorporating a simple care routine, you can guarantee its efficiency and avoid costly repairs or replacements down the road.

One vital aspect of water softener maintenance consists of frequently monitoring the system for any signs of wear and tear. This includes checking the salt level, observing the brine tank, and looking for any leaks or cracks.

Furthermore, it's critical to drain the system on a consistent basis to remove any built-up minerals or sediment. This will help minimize clogs and ensure that the system functions at its best.
